During a meeting with filmmakers in France, President Lee Jae-myung instructed that the introduction of the SOFICA system, designed to promote investment in new and independent films, be officially reviewed. This measure aims to improve the domestic ecosystem, which is heavily skewed toward blockbuster commercial films. President Lee Jae-myung, currently on a state visit to France, expressed concern regarding the Korean film industry, stating, "It looks glamorous on the outside, but it appears to be rotting on the inside." On the 7th (local time), President Lee held a meeting with Korean filmmakers in the field while attending the "Lumière Summit," a summit for the film and video industry, held near Nice in southern France.
